Bandhawa Khurd Village - Pali, Umaria

Bandhawa Khurd is a village situated in the Pali tehsil of Umaria district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 36 km from the tehsil headquarters in Pali and around 70 km from the district headquarters in Umaria. Chandaniya ser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bandhawa Khurd village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bandhawa Khurd is 468152. The village covers a total geographical area of 280 hectares and falls under the 484001 pincode. Shahdol is the nearest town, located about 5 km away.

Bandhawa Khurd village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Bandhawa Khurd

As per Census 2011, Bandhawa Khurd village has a total population of 622 people, consisting of 295 males and 327 females. The village has 159 households and a sex ratio of 1,108 females per 1,000 males. There are 105 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 252 literate and 370 illiterate residents. Additionally, 59 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 438 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bandhawa Khurd

Bandhawa Khurd is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Bandhawa Khurd.
